WiSA E wireless multichannel software offers significant advantages for both consumer electronics manufacturers and end users. For manufacturers, WiSA E integrates multichannel wireless audio functionality into streaming media devices without the need for costly hardware solutions, thereby reducing production costs and enhancing product offerings.

As software, WiSA E functionality can be unlocked at any time, providing end users the freedom to add multichannel audio capabilities on their timeframe and offering manufacturers an aftermarket revenue stream based on consumer activation. WiSA E-certified devices offer interoperability seamlessly across different products and brands, ensuring broad compatibility and consumer appeal. End users benefit from the ease of expanding their audio setup, as WiSA E allows them to seamlessly add satellite speakers at any time, creating an immersive home audio environment. This flexibility and user-friendly approach make WiSA E a compelling solution for bringing high-quality wireless audio to a mass market.

According to Grand View Research, the wireless audio device market was valued at $107.92 billion in 2023 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 15.5% from 2023 to 2030, surpassing $296 billion. Interoperability and compatibility issues have been known as factors that hinder the growth of the wireless audio device market, which presents a massive opportunity for WiSA’s audio solutions.
